Calm Down, Beauty, I’m Just an Electrician
Calm Down, Beauty, I’m Just an Electrician Plot:
A sudden blackout throws electrician A Ming into the private party of a beautiful writer, Sophie. Hoping to fix the circuit quietly and leave, he’s mistaken for a mysterious VIP and dragged into a farcical comedy of errors. As his true identity teeters on exposure, A Ming must play along—while Sophie grows curiously intrigued by his “accidental” charm. A hilarious case of mistaken identity sparks an unexpected connection between an electrician and a literary star.
